The paint was colored with unstable copper acetate verdigris pigment, which over time would degrade to a dark almost-black, forming what we now call Charleston Green. You can spot this unique shade all over the historic district - it's often used for trim, shutters, and doors. Verdigris Green.

When choosing the ceiling color for the screened porch of our 2018 Idea House, designer Jenny Keenan stuck to tradition: piazza blue. She wanted the cottage to include a mix of classic and modern details, and no element is more time-honored than the blue porch ceiling. "We pretty much use it in all of our projects in the Lowcountry," she says.

Have you ever noticed that porches in Charleston usually have a light blue paint upon their ceilings?The Gullah Geechee descendants of the enslaved African planters thought that soft, blue-green paint would keep the " haints," or evil spirits, away.. The belief of Blue Haint's protection stems from cultural influences originating from Barbados.Yes, Barbados.

A paint guide to Charleston's quintessential hues. (Clockwise form top left) - Haint Blue, Charleston Green, Verdigris Green, and Yellow Ochre Limewash. Long before people were Instagramming Rainbow Row's wild colors, Charleston was a city of Georgian earth-based shades, brilliant Greek Revival greens, and piazza-ceiling blues.

Verdigris Green Between hints of Haint Blue and the near black of Charleston Green, sits Verdigris. And to confuse the whole official color debate even more, from all of our time walking around and taking in the architectural wonders of Charleston, when talking about mere quantity, Verdigris Green might REALLY be the official color of Charleston.. Note: "Blue " has a place in Charleston folklore. Sometimes called "Haint Blue " It's used on piazza ceilings to imitate the sky and keep insects from settling.
